Analysis
The most recent figure for further processed sawnwood, non-coniferous (export/import) β import in China is 172,117 1000 USD, measured in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 2.1% on the previous year and down 2.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, further processed sawnwood, non-coniferous (export/import) β import in China peaked at 348,693 1000 USD in 2021 and was at its lowest, 118,668 1000 USD, in 2009.
China ranks 1st of 214 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
